Twins, infielder Nishioka close to deal

Published Dec. 16, 2010 12:00 a.m. ET

Japanese infielder Tsuyoshi Nishioka will be in Minnesota on Thursday for a physical, the strongest sign yet that a deal between him and the Twins is near.

The two sides are “very close” to an agreement, according to a source with knowledge of the discussions.

The Twins won exclusive negotiating rights to Nishioka through the posting process last month, bidding about $5.3 million, sources said.

Nishioka, 26, won the Japanese batting title last season with a .346 average. The Twins will use him at either shortstop or second, with Alexi Casilla manning the other position.

The Twins are expected to sign Nishioka to a three-year contract worth between $3 million and $5 million per season.
